What is the impact of PPP theory on the valuation of cryptocurrencies?
KosmoMar 13, 2023 · 2 years ago3 answers
Can you explain how the Purchasing Power Parity (PPP) theory affects the valuation of cryptocurrencies? How does it relate to the pricing and value of digital currencies? What are the key factors that influence the PPP theory in the context of cryptocurrencies?
3 answers
- Awes KhanNov 18, 2020 · 5 years agoThe impact of PPP theory on the valuation of cryptocurrencies is significant. PPP theory suggests that the exchange rate between two currencies should equalize the purchasing power of each currency. In the context of cryptocurrencies, this means that the value of a digital currency should reflect its purchasing power in the real world. Factors such as inflation rates, interest rates, and economic stability can influence the valuation of cryptocurrencies based on PPP theory. For example, if a country has high inflation, its currency's purchasing power decreases, which could lead to a decrease in the value of cryptocurrencies denominated in that currency.
- Sinkan SuravitaJan 03, 2022 · 3 years agoPPP theory is an interesting concept when it comes to valuing cryptocurrencies. It suggests that the price of a digital currency should be determined by its purchasing power in the real world. This means that if a cryptocurrency has a high purchasing power, its value should be higher. However, in reality, the valuation of cryptocurrencies is influenced by various factors such as market demand, investor sentiment, and technological advancements. While PPP theory provides a theoretical framework, it may not fully capture the complexities of the cryptocurrency market.
